The second part of the epic tetralogy Peasants. The novel depicts the difficult winter life in the village of Lipce, deepens the conflicts within Boryna's family, the passionate relationship between Antko and Jagna, and the growing tensions in the village
The novel Between Light and Darkness (1891) is based on a critique of the bureaucratic apparatus and government structures, for which reason it was censored and published with a changed ending.
